Reconditioning UPVC door panels is a simple process that can be undertaken with the right tools and materials. Below is a detailed guide to help you through the refurbishment process.
Materials RequiredMaterialFunctionUPVC CleanerTo remove dirt and gunk from the panels.Great SandpaperTo smooth out scratches.UPVC Repair KitTo fill out any fractures or damages.Paint or UPVC Spray PaintFor color remediation.Primer (if necessary)To assist the paint adhere better.Soft ClothsTo wipe down the surface area and for polishing.Protective GlovesTo protect hands while working.Repair Process
Clean the Panels:.Start by thoroughly cleaning the UPVC door panels with an ideal UPVC cleaner to remove dirt, grease, and grime. Ensure that you clean up the edges and corners carefully.
Sand Down Scratches:.If there are obvious scratches or scuffs, lightly sand the affected locations using fine sandpaper. Be mild to prevent harming the surface even more.
Repair Damage:.For cracks or deeper damages, use a UPVC Panel Repair Experts kit to fill the harmed locations. Follow the maker's guidelines for the very best outcomes and permit the repair to treat totally.
Guide Application:.If the door requires painting, use a primer initially to help the paint adhere correctly. This action is specifically important for locations where damage has actually been repaired.
Paint:.When the primer is dry, apply a quality UPVC paint or spray paint in your preferred color. Multiple thin coats are more suitable to attain an even finish, permitting sufficient drying time between coats.
Last Touches:.After the paint has actually dried, check the door for any locations that may need touch-ups. Once pleased, buff the door with a soft cloth for added shine.
Reinstall Fixtures:.If you removed any components during cleaning or painting, carefully re-install them, guaranteeing they are secure.
Upkeep Tips Post-Refurbishment
To keep the newly refurbished condition of your UPVC door panels, think about these pointers:

A: The frequency of refurbishment can vary depending upon environmental aspects and usage. It's normally suggested to evaluate the panels every couple of years or faster if you notice any indications of damage.
Q2: Can I use routine paint on UPVC doors?
A: It's finest to use paint specifically created for UPVC Door Maintenance to make sure proper adhesion and durability. Regular paints may not adhere well and could lead to peeling.
Q3: Is reconditioning UPVC panels a DIY task?
A: Yes! With the right tools and a little persistence, many homeowners can successfully refurbish their UPVC Panel Maintenance door panels. However, more considerable damage may need professional assistance.
Q4: Can I use a power washer to tidy UPVC doors?
A: While it might be tempting, utilizing a power washer can harm UPVC surface areas. It's much safer to utilize a soft fabric or sponge along with an ideal cleaner.
